Job summary

The University of Agder (UiA) invites applications for a 100% PhD Research Fellow position in Electrical Engineering at Campus Grimstad, within the Energy Systems Group and the national SOLAR centre. The appointment spans three years with a negotiable start date and admission to UiA’s PhD programme.

The project focuses on power quality monitoring, EMT-based simulations, and grid hosting capacity with high PV penetration.

Qualifications

  • Master’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Renewable Energy, or related field.
  • Experience with scientific programming and data analysis, preferably MATLAB or Python.
  • Good written and spoken English; English proficiency documented if NOKUT requirements apply.

Responsibilities

  • Develop digital twins for pilot distribution and transmission grids with high PV integration.
  • Create an event-based power quality assessment framework with EMT simulations.
  • Evaluate grid control strategies to increase PV hosting capacity and optimize losses.
  • Validate research through hardware‑in‑the‑loop lab experiments within the SOLAR consortium.
